Massive hemorrhage in hemangioblastomas
Neurosurgical Review, 08/24/09
Pedro JRDS et al. – Hemorrhage following hemangioblastoma embolization and the association of this tumor with other bleeding lesions, such as arteriovenous malformations and aneurysms, is also discussed.
